Abstract

The agri-food sector is responsible for generating a large amount of solid waste, which is currently not properly disposed of or reused in an environmentally friendly manner. The reintegration of these waste materials into the production cycle allows for greater economic gain from raw material sources by exploring biomass for various purposes such as the production of bioproducts, precursor materials for biofuels, and energy. Therefore, the objective of this project is to explore a set of bioprocesses within the concept of a biorefinery to develop technological routes for the hydrolysis, purification, fermentative and enzymatic processes, as well as adsorption of the agro-industrial waste from cashew apple peduncles. Subcritical water will be used for biomass hydrolysis to obtain fermentable sugars. The cellulose residue will undergo an enzymatic process to obtain cellulose oligosaccharides. The hydrolysate will be purified to obtain sugars with a high degree of purity. Finally, fermentative processes will be applied to obtain ethanol, lactic acid, and biogas, with the latter being subsequently purified. All processes employed to obtain co-products will be evaluated from a technical and economic standpoint. Therefore, it is expected that this project will contribute to the development and integration of technologies that can support decarbonization of the energy matrix and promote the transition to a circular economy based on the agro-industrial waste from cashew apple peduncles.
